Coldstream accumulators stabilize pressure and flow rate problems that affect combination boiler performance(15/07/2008)
The Coldstream range of accumulators from GAH Heating is a solution to stabilize pressure and flow rate problems that affect combination boiler performance. Pressure without flow rate supporting it will lead to pressure drops, poor performance at water outlets and customer dissatisfaction. GAH Heating launches external range of oil condensing boilers(19/03/2008)
GAH Heating is expanding its thermeco brand of high efficiency oil condensing boilers with the launch of an external range. The wall mounted thermeco is available in 12/16 or 16/25 models and boasts outputs of 40-55,000 BTU per hour and 55-85,000 BTU/hr respectively.
